CO₂, nitrogen and mixed gas for beer dispense systems
Different drinks need different gases to achieve the right flavour, mouthfeel and visual finish. Adams Gas supplies a full range of beer dispense gases, suitable for all common cellar systems.
CO₂ gas cylinders for beer dispense
CO₂ is the most widely used cellar gas and is essential for drinks that rely on natural carbonation.
CO₂ is commonly used for:
-
Lagers
-
Ciders
-
Carbonated beers
-
Soft drinks and post-mix systems
Because CO₂ dissolves readily into liquid, it helps maintain crispness and effervescence. Correct pressure regulation is important to avoid over-carbonation, which is why Adams Gas supplies professionally tested CO₂ cylinders suitable for commercial cellar use.

Nitrogen gas bottles for a smoother pour
Nitrogen behaves differently from CO₂ and is used where texture and presentation are key.
Nitrogen is ideal for:
-
Stouts and porters
-
Nitrogenated ales
-
Beers that need a creamy mouthfeel
As nitrogen does not dissolve easily into beer, it allows a higher dispense pressure without increasing carbonation. This creates the dense head and cascading effect associated with stout-style beers.

Mixed beer gas cylinders
Many modern pubs and bars use mixed gas cylinders, combining CO₂ and nitrogen in controlled ratios to support a wider product range.
Mixed gas is commonly used for:
-
Ales and bitters
-
Cream-flow beers
-
Multi-line dispense systems
A typical blend is 60% CO₂ and 40% nitrogen, although other ratios may be used depending on the system and beer style. Mixed gas helps deliver balanced carbonation, improved mouthfeel and reliable head retention.

Safety note: CO₂ is heavier than air and can displace oxygen in enclosed spaces, so adequate ventilation is essential in cellar areas.
